By Sadiq Umar – The National Assembly on Thursday passed the 2017 Appropriation budget sum of  N7,441,175,486,758, even as it disclosed that it would spend N125billion as its estimate budget this year.

The two arms released the breakdown of its 2017 Budget of N125 billion, with additional N10 billion to NASS’ 2016 Budget of N115bn during plenary on Thursday.

President of the Senate Bukola Saraki hailed the lawmakers for their efforts on the budget.

He also restated the parliament’s resolve to promote more transparency in the National Assembly spending in accordance with earlier promise of making the budget of the legislative arm of government public.

“I appreciate the cooperation of members of the Executive and the remarkable difference from the 2016 process, said Senate president Bukola Saraki.

“It is my hope that this budget of recovery would go a long way and take us out of recession”.

It is the first time in many years that the National Assembly would make public details of its spending for a fiscal year.
